How do you protect a cowhide rug?
- Vacuum regularly.
- Never soak your cow hide rug when you are cleaning it as this can cause long term damage to the rug.
- Never using alkaline cleansing soap on your cowhide rug.
- Scotch Guard or other fabric protectors can help your cow hide rug repel stains before they happen.

Thereof, how do you maintain a cowhide rug?
You may also want to consider using a warm, damp cloth to clean your rug, pillow, purse or decorative piece. Use very mild soap, warm water and a soft rag or soft brush. You don't have to follow the direction of the hair. Just remember to pat the cowhide dry to remove excess water.
Beside above, how do you clean urine from a cowhide rug? With urine or vomit spills in particular, it may help to follow up and wipe with a damp cloth dipped into a dilute solution of 9.5 oz water and 0.5 oz white vinegar, which will help with pH balance and odor removal. Cowhide rug cleaning should never involve soaking or saturating the rug with water.
can you vacuum a cowhide rug?
Cowhide rugs are durable, hardwearing and easy to clean, requiring minimal effort to keep them looking great. It is fine to vacuum your rug, but use the brush attachment on your vacuum cleaner and vacuum the rug in the direction of the hairs to prevent any unwanted hair loss.
How do I keep my cowhide rug from curling?
Tame a curling Cowhide
- Lightly mist the top and underneath of your cowhide with water.
- Place a towel underneath your cowhide and one on top of the curling piece.
- Pile up some of your heavy books on top of the curling piece and leave overnight.
- Or steam iron with a cloth between the iron and your cowhide.

How to Clean Cowhide Leather- Gently brush dirt and dust from the leather using a soft brush.
- Dip a clean, white rag in warm water.
- Rub the rag on a bar of saddle soap.
- Scrub the surface of the leather with a light touch.
- Rinse the rag completely between each section, switching to a new rag if it becomes soiled.
